Salfit Ma'an - Israeli occupation forces stormed the city of Salfit today, Wednesday, amidst the firing of sound bombs. Citizens said that a number of occupation vehicles stormed the city, amidst the firing of sound bombs, setting up checkpoints, forcing shop owners to close their shops, preventing citizens from moving, and pasting posters on the walls warning farmers and agricultural equipment dealers against selling, possessing, or using illegal fertilizers. Citizens indicated that the occupation's storming of the city coincided with the holding of the high school exams. Source: Maan News Agency
